How to submit

Process

We use Submittable.

Cover letters

If you are a former Terrain.org contributor, please remind us in your cover letter.

Eligibility

No specific eligibility requirements

Formatting

This magazine does not list any details on their website for this section.

Rights for published work

Terrain.org acquires online publication rights for the life of the journal, as well as the right to reprint the work in an anthology.

Additional info

Accept previously published: as long as the work is not available elsewhere online. Original, unpublished work preferred though. Offer expedited response: but only for Letter to America submissions, and even there it's about 2 months We do pay contributors when we can, particularly if they meet our goals under our 2020 Statement on Racial Justice (https://www.terrain.org/about/racial-justice/).

About the Magazine

Founded in 1997 | United States

With a focus on place, climate, and justice, Terrain.org is an independent magazine of literature, artwork, commentary, and design founded in 1997. Contributions to in Terrain.org are of the highest quality, by a variety of contributors for a diverse, informed, and progressive audience. Contributors range from icons in the field of nature writing, such as Wendell Berry, Jane Hirshfield, Camille T. Dungy, and Joy Harjo, to essential new voices that are changing both writing and place itself, such as Aisha Sabatini Sloan, José Angel Araguz, and Joe Wilkins. Likewise, our critically acclaimed series—including Letters to America, A Life of Science, and Pam Houston’s Twenty Words During Lockdown—respond in real time to the most urgent social and environmental justice issues of the day. The works Terrain.org publishes on a rolling schedule merge literary and graphic art with science and activism in a beautiful, interactive design.
